The agriculture sector is one of the key applications for Hydraulic Adjustment Stone Buriers, primarily due to the need for efficient soil preparation. Farmers and agricultural workers often face the challenge of dealing with stones and other debris that can interfere with planting and crop growth. Hydraulic stone buriers are used to bury these obstacles deep into the soil, ensuring that the land is smooth and free of hindrances. The increased adoption of modern farming techniques and machinery that promotes high productivity is driving the growth in this application. Additionally, stone buriers help prevent damage to other equipment like tractors and plows, which is crucial for maintaining a smooth workflow in agricultural operations.
Furthermore, these machines have grown popular because they allow for versatile and adaptive operations, particularly in regions with stony or rocky terrains. They contribute significantly to preparing the land for the planting of various crops, offering an efficient solution that reduces manual labor and time spent on stone removal. The trend towards mechanized farming in many developing countries has also contributed to the increased demand for hydraulic adjustment stone buriers in agriculture, improving both land efficiency and overall crop yields. These factors highlight the ongoing need for stone buriers in agriculture, where functionality and efficiency are paramount.

1. What is a hydraulic adjustment stone burier?
A hydraulic adjustment stone burier is a machine used to bury stones and debris into the soil, often for agricultural and construction applications. It operates hydraulically, offering adjustable depth and precision.
2. How does a hydraulic adjustment stone burier work?
The machine uses hydraulic power to adjust the depth of its working mechanism, allowing it to bury stones and debris into the soil, preparing the land for further use or construction.
3. What industries use hydraulic adjustment stone buriers?
Hydraulic stone buriers are used in agriculture, construction, landscaping, mining, and forestry for efficient land preparation and debris removal.
4. Can hydraulic adjustment stone buriers be used in rocky terrain?
Yes, these machines are specifically designed for use in rocky or uneven terrain, making them ideal for clearing debris and preparing land in challenging environments.
5. What are the advantages of using hydraulic stone buriers in agriculture?
They help prepare soil for planting by burying stones and debris, which improves crop yields, reduces equipment damage, and saves time compared to manual labor.
